|
|
| 27629 | 30 Feet 1930 Sea Lyon Triple Cockpit | $185,000 |  |
|
| Howard Lyon was a smooth talking salesman who convinced Gar Wood to grant him an exclusive arrangement to sell his runabouts after Gar watched him sell so many of his 33 Foot Baby Gar's in record numbers. Lyon would eventually go onto build his own boats after buying land in City Island New York and offered up to 6 different models of his runabouts including the most poplular 30 foot version wit the 225 HP Sterling Petrol motor. . This is a fabulous multi-award winning 1930 30' Sea Lyon was restored in 1993, and just completly refinished in 2007. Cold molded epoxy construction throughout. 800ci Sterling Petrel, as original. Green leather upholstery. A great, large runabout, in excellent condition. One of only 5 in existence. Includes triple axle trailer and possible transportation. |

|
|
| 26053 | 30 Feet 1929 Sea Lyon Model 45 Runabout | $105,000 -  |  |
|
| Howard Lyon was a smooth talking salesman who convinced Garwood to grant him the exclusive arrangement to sell his runabouts after Gar watched him successfully sell his 33 foot Baby Gar's in record numbers. Eventually going on to buid his own boats, Lyon purchased land in City Island, New York and went on to sell six different models of runabouts including the 30 foot Sea Lyon with a 200 HP Sterling Petrol engine which sold for $5950.00 in 1929. Known for their level riding and excellent visibility, 5 section windshiled the long deck boats were made to be at the high end of the market and compnared quite favorably to the other boats on the market at that time. The stock market crash ended his dream in 1952 and left behind a handful of exquisite boats including this vessel which WON the Lake Tahoe Show in 1990 and was lovingly sored away after that and has sat until nbow. the boat is in showroom condition today and is awaiting it's new owner. |

| 26043 | 32.5 Feet 1928-1929 Orville Wright's Gidley Boat Works Launch | $495,000 |  |
|
| Purchased by famous inventor, Orville Wright and owned by him until his death in 1947, this Gidley Boat Works Launch is a piece of history. The Wright Brother's of course are credited with the first manned flight with their havier than air machine and this boat was used to ferry Mr. Wright and his family back and forth to his island cottage in Canada.
Named Kittyhawk, Orville was a familar site seen driving his boat in and around Georgian Bay until the time when he was recalled to Washington. The launch was completely restored to her original pristine condition at the Greavette Boat Co., in Gravenhurst, Ontario. Complete with gleaming chrome, fenders true to the era and wicker furniture, she was awarded Antique Boat of the Year at the Toronto International Boat Show,1976.
